Output 95d17938db824e8bc5a26ebe7b9f04b7b6234b269a9f3e8f4b32531176c67c6e:1

value
796973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688366ac0342ea4acef0a23fccac846a24b5823d OP_EQUAL
address
3BDdcQ9n5FezFB9bz76xN5NbDUnhXX4uVL
transaction
95d17938db824e8bc5a26ebe7b9f04b7b6234b269a9f3e8f4b32531176c67c6e
spent
true